Tanghulu Recipe

Description

Make this traditional Chinese candied fruit snack at home. Tanghulu is easy to customize with your favorite fruits.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up sugar
  • 1/2 cup water
  • 1 pound strawberries, or other fruit

Instructions

  1. Wash and dry your choice of fruit.
  2. Thread the fruit onto skewers.
  3. Combine sugar and water in a saucepan.
  4. Heat over medium heat, without stirring, until the sugar dissolves and the mixture reaches 300°F (150°C) on a candy thermometer.
  5. Quickly dip the fruit skewers into the hot sugar syrup, coating evenly.
  6. Place the dipped fruit on a greased surface or silicone mat to cool and harden.
  7. Serve immediately and enjoy your homemade Tanghulu.

Notes

  • Use a candy thermometer to ensure the sugar reaches the correct temperature.
  • Work quickly when dipping the fruit, as the sugar hardens fast.
  • You can use various fruits like grapes, kiwi, or mandarin oranges.
